    Default cnc jerk controller

    Hi, i'm looking for an affordable CNC standalone controller with jerk (acceleration profile) adjustment. Can't find anything that doesn't require PC connection. Currently i'm using rmhv2.1 maybe there is software update that allow jerk control?

    Default Re: cnc jerk controller

    You could use Grbl, which runs on an arduino and then use a second arduino to send the g-code files to it. I had a couple arduinos set up this way and it worked well, but I ultimately decided that I had enough old laptops, netbooks and tablets laying around to run Grbl that way.

    Speaking of tablets, there is an android based tablet/phone software that is out there that can control Gbrl from an old phone or tablet. using a USB otg connection or through bluetooth. I haven't tried it, but here it is.

    BTW, I use Grbl on my cnc milling machine and it works really well, but has a few limitations. However, I have found that the trajectory planner works very well and provides good jerk control.
